Output 7706e9db995442feb9b4191353f0e02609f1e4b9a8af61afcbd6806dcd2305d4:22

value
4077931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b8b63bbfd2f5da224a1353da4ed1402aa3041e OP_EQUAL
address
37bESpp9scug8f3CAqcgPd5mysa8a71Z6Z
transaction
7706e9db995442feb9b4191353f0e02609f1e4b9a8af61afcbd6806dcd2305d4
spent
true